Onboarding — Wagestone support. As of this quarter, payroll exports moved from CSV to the new WGX format. Old imports will fail; point customers to the converter in the admin panel. Escalate anything involving tax fields. To access the export sandbox for reproducing customer issues, unlock the shared vault with the recovery passphrase below.

unlock words, hahip-yagef: zorok-novmir-zorix-silax

Changed defaults in Splitfork, our assignment service. Bucketing now uses sticky hashing per account instead of per session, and the holdout slice grew from 2% to 5%. Callers relying on session-level reassignment must opt in explicitly. Review the diff against the new baseline; the updated default configuration is listed below.

config for tagep-kajof:
[casir]
port = 6379
region = south-1
host = casir.paliqdyn.example
team = tamax
timeout_ms = 250
retries = 2

**Metrics sidecar — release notes for the RM**

Every Corvette-line service ships with the Tallyglass sidecar, which aggregates counters before forwarding to the Ledgerpond collector. Before cutting a release, confirm the sidecar image tag matches the manifest pin and that the forwarding credential has been rotated this quarter. The sidecar reads its credential from `/opt/tallyglass/.env`, which must include this line:

secret setting of tawif-tajop: COURIER_KEY13=819c65d82d2bd

## Environments — InkwellMD Rendering Pipeline

InkwellMD converts user markdown into sanitized HTML across three environments: dev, staging, and prod. Each environment runs its own sanitizer ruleset and cache tier, so never copy settings between them blindly. As a new contractor, start in dev and confirm renders match staging snapshots before touching prod. The current prod environment uses the values shown below.

deployment values, yadup-kadug:
[sorys]
port = 5672
team = noveth
host = sorys.orvexcorp.example
region = south-4
access_code = ac_deddc1
timeout_ms = 1500